About Ernst Mach

An Austrian physicist and philosopher, noted for his contributions to physics such as the study of shock waves. He was a major influence on logical positivism and American pragmatism.

About Erwin Schrödinger

A Nobel Prize-winning Austrian-Irish physicist best known for his "Schrödinger's cat" thought experiment.
